Pin #114: Mr. Toad's Wild Ride
This is one of my favorite pins (I say that a lot, don't I?). It's a pin from the Mr. Toad's Wild Ride attraction at Disneyland. It features Mr. Toad and Mole in one of the cars from the classic attraction, which is displayed in all gold. It's really cool looking! One thing you might notice that is off on this pin is the coloration of Toad and Mole. It looks as though the paints were switched and Mole got painted in green while Toad ended up in a more flesh color. It's just another cool feature, even if it was a mistake, of this pin. This pin was released in 2005 as part of the Happiest Homecoming on Earth celebration. As soon as I saw it, I had to have it. First of all, it's one of the coolest looking pins I have. And second, Mr. Toad's is one of my top five favorite rides at Disneyland, so I love collecting pins for that ride. They are actually a little harder to find than you might think, too. But this one really stands out on my board.

Pin #111: Challenger Mission Patch
This is one of the coolest pins I have! It is a replica of the STS-7 mission patch worn by the Space Shuttle astronauts. This was the seventh shuttle mission and the second for the space shuttle Challenger. No, it wasn't that Challenger mission, but it was still a notable mission. You will notice the names of the astronauts on the bottom of the pin. One name that should stand out is Ride. This was Sally Ride's first mission. She was the first female astronaut, so this was a very important mission. Other interesting notes about this pin are that the seven stars represent that this was the seventh shuttle mission, as does the arm, which extends from the shuttle to form a 7. And the five armed symbol on the right represents the flight crew, consisting of four males and one female. Once again, it's really one of the coolest pins I have. I don't know where I got it, but I love having it.
